The Cork Conundrum: Myth vs. Material Reality

Many assume cork is “too soft” for heavy-duty closet use—especially for rigid, high-mass items like raw or selvedge denim. That’s a misconception rooted in conflating cork rubber (a synthetic blend) with solid, high-density natural cork. The latter, when properly harvested, processed, and cured, achieves compressive strengths of 3.5–5.0 MPa—comparable to medium-density fiberboard—and rebounds fully after repeated load cycles.

Why Cork Outperforms “Just Hang It Anywhere” Logic

The most widespread—but damaging—practice is hanging denim by the waistband on thin, smooth plastic or wire hangers. This creates micro-tears at the belt loops, distorts the waistband’s elastic memory, and accelerates seam stress. Cork eliminates this: its micro-textured surface grips fabric without pressure points, while its slight give absorbs kinetic energy from movement and gravity. Unlike rigid alternatives, cork doesn’t transfer vibration or impact—critical in closets where doors slam or shelves shift.

Proven Steps for Long-Term Cork Success

  • Select density over thickness: Prioritize cork rated ≥220 kg/m³—this ensures compression resistance, not just bulk.
  • Anchor to structure: Wall-mounted cork rails must hit wall studs; use stainless steel lag screws, not toggle bolts.
  • 💡 Store denim folded on cork shelves (not hung) if weight exceeds 10 kg per linear foot—this preserves drape and reduces hanger fatigue.
  • ⚠️ Never expose cork to direct sunlight or humidity above 65% RH for >4 hours—it can oxidize or swell irreversibly.
  • 💡 Refresh grip annually: lightly sand surface with 220-grit paper, then wipe with vinegar-water (1:3) to restore microtexture.

Debunking the “More Support = Better” Fallacy

A common but counterproductive habit is adding redundant layers—like lining cork shelves with felt or placing denim inside plastic garment bags “for protection.” This traps moisture, encourages mildew, and defeats cork’s breathability—the very property that inhibits bacterial growth and odor retention in denim. Less intervention is more effective: cork’s natural antimicrobial tannins and open-cell porosity actively regulate microclimate. Let it breathe. Let it work.
